SUBJECT:

Lease Agreement for land from I.H. 37 Land, Ltd. for the Salado Creek Greenway Trail project from Southside Lions Park to Southeast Military Drive


SUMMARY:

This ordinance authorizes execution of a Lease Agreement for land from I.H. 37 Land, Ltd. for a term of up to 20 years for the Salado Creek Greenway Trail (Southside Lions Park to Southeast Military Drive) project, included in the FY 2018-2023 Capital Improvement Program budget, located in Council District 3.


BACKGROUND INFORMATION:

The proposed Lease Agreement will allow for the expansion of the Salado Creek Greenway Trail from Southside Lions Park to Southeast Military Drive, enhancing bike and pedestrian connectivity and park access for adjacent residents. The property is located within the 100-year floodplain, adjacent to the Salado Creek Greenway Trail in Council District 3. This action is consistent with the City's objectives to acquire and preserve open space along San Antonio waterways and to develop multi-use hike and bike trails, trailheads, signage and associated amenities for use by San Antonio residents and visitors.

The Salado Creek Greenway is part of the Howard W. Peak Greenway Trails system, which is funded through sales tax initiatives approved by voters in 2000, 2005, 2010, and 2015. The objectives of the Program are to acquire and preserve open space along San Antonio waterways and to develop multi-use hike and bike trails, trailheads, signage and associated amenities for use by San Antonio residents and visitors.

The segment of the Salado Creek Greenway from Southside Lions Park to Southeast Military Drive is currently in design. This segment will be just over three miles long, making a total of 11 miles of connected trail from Ft. Sam Houston to Southeast Military Drive, where a new trailhead parking area will be built.
